Java Fullstack Developer
📍 Location: India – Remote
đź§ľ Type: Contract / Full Time
👥 Open Positions: 3
🔹 Job Summary
The Java Fullstack Developer (Software Engineer – Senior Associate) will be responsible for the design, development, testing, and maintenance of software solutions that address complex business challenges within the healthcare industry. The role involves collaborating with cross-functional teams—including Product Design, Business Analysis, QA, and Customer Support—to deliver scalable, efficient, and high-performing applications. The ideal candidate will possess strong technical expertise in Java, Spring Boot, Microservices, Angular, and database technologies, alongside a solid understanding of software development best practices.
🔹 Key Responsibilities
- Design, develop, and maintain scalable Java Fullstack applications using Spring, Spring Boot, Microservices, JavaScript, and Angular.
- Collaborate with product and business teams to translate business requirements into technical solutions.
- Participate in all stages of the software development lifecycle—analysis, design, coding, testing, and deployment.
- Develop and consume RESTful and SOAP-based web services; perform testing using tools like SoapUI.
- Write efficient, maintainable, and reusable code adhering to software engineering standards.
- Work closely with QA to identify, troubleshoot, and resolve software defects.
- Support production environments and perform root cause analysis for application issues.
- Contribute to continuous improvement by evaluating and implementing new technologies, tools, and frameworks.
🔹 Required Skills
- Proficient in Java, Spring, Spring Boot, and Microservices architecture.
- Front-end development experience with JavaScript and Angular frameworks.
- Strong understanding of web services (REST/SOAP) and experience with testing tools like SoapUI.
- Hands-on experience with databases such as SQL and MongoDB.
- Solid grasp of software development methodologies (Agile/Scrum).
- Strong debugging, analytical, and problem-solving skills.
- Excellent communication and collaboration abilities across teams.
🔹 Qualifications & Experience
- Bachelor’s degree in Computer Science, Information Technology, or related field.
- 3–6 years of professional experience in Fullstack software development.
- Proven experience in Java-based backend systems and Angular-based front-end development.
- Exposure to healthcare industry applications is a plus.
- Familiarity with CI/CD pipelines, version control (Git), and API integration is advantageous.
🔹 Ideal Candidate
A technically sound and detail-oriented Java Fullstack Developer who thrives in a collaborative, fast-paced environment. The candidate should be capable of delivering robust software solutions that drive operational efficiency and enhance user experience within healthcare technology platforms.